The resolution of a elution is actually a quantitative evaluate of how well two elution peaks could be differentiated in a very chromatographic separation. It is actually defined as the primary difference in retention instances involving The 2 peaks, divided via the put together widths of the elution peaks.

Should the composition from the mobile period stays continual through the HPLC separation, the separation is deemed an isocratic elution. Usually the one way to elute every one of the compounds in the sample in a reasonable amount of time, even though continue to sustaining peak resolution, is always to change how HPLC works the ratio of polar to non-polar compounds inside the cellular stage in the course of the sample operate. Often known as gradient chromatography, Here is the technique of choice when a sample includes elements of an array of polarities. For any reverse stage gradient, the solvent starts out fairly polar and little by little results in being extra non-polar. The gradient elution features quite possibly the most total separation in the peaks, devoid of getting an inordinate period of time.
